What Are Personalized Dental Prosthetics?

Custom dental prosthetics describe custom-made oral appliances developed to change or support damaged, missing out on, or deteriorated teeth. These might include crowns, bridges, dentures, inlays, onlays, and implant-supported reconstructions. Unlike mass-produced or standard-sized alternatives, these prosthetics are made based upon the patient's exact mouth framework, attack alignment, and color of surrounding teeth.

The process starts with an extensive assessment and accurate imaging, usually utilizing digital scanners. The collected information is after that made use of to produce a prosthetic that fits seamlessly with the individual's existing oral structure.

Types of Personalized Dental Prosthetics

There's a vast array of prosthetic tools that can be custom-fabricated depending upon the client's problem and treatment strategy:

    Crowns and Bridges: Developed to restore damaged or missing teeth with strong, cosmetically matched materials. Dentures: Complete or partial dentures are created to very closely replicate the appearance and function of all-natural teeth and gums. Implant-Supported Prosthetics: Reconstructions placed on dental implants to supply extra stability and an all-natural bite. Inlays and Onlays: A conservative solution for bring back tooth framework when a full crown isn't necessary.

The Duty of Innovation in Custom Prosthetics

Modern dental laboratories depend heavily on sophisticated electronic devices to create precise and premium prosthetics. Digital impressions have actually changed untidy physical mold and mildews, using better precision and client convenience. CAD/CAM modern technology allows the design and milling of prosthetics with pinpoint accuracy, lowering human error and enhancing turnaround times.

3 D printing has actually also made substantial strides in the dental field, permitting the production of complicated forms and great details that were once difficult to accomplish manually. With these devices, oral specialists can deliver prosthetics that satisfy both the clinical and aesthetic needs of clients more effectively than ever before before.
